TīmeklisTesting and your child. An essential part of managing your child’s diabetes is frequently testing their blood sugar levels (also known as blood glucose levels) to help avoid highs and lows – and knowing when to test for ketones. At times, this testing may be difficult – both for you and your child, especially if they’re very young. TīmeklisNon-diabetic hyperglycaemia, also known as pre-diabetes or impaired glucose regulation, refers to raised blood glucose levels, but not in the diabetic range. Tīmeklis2024. gada 15. janv. · At your annual diabetes care review the doctor or nurse will: Take your height and weight (to check if you are under or overweight) Take your blood pressure. Review your blood glucose control. Review your HbA1c and cholesterol levels. Discuss any issues you have with your diabetes or health in general.
